Is LPL Financial Holdings, Inc. overvalued or undervalued?
2025-11-05 11:10:07As of 31 October 2025, the valuation grade for LPL Financial Holdings, Inc. moved from attractive to fair, indicating a shift in its perceived value. The company appears to be fairly valued based on its current metrics, with a P/E ratio of 42, a Price to Book Value of 15.99, and an EV to EBITDA of 19.93. In comparison to peers, Ameriprise Financial, Inc. has a higher P/E of 48.17, while State Street Corp. shows a lower P/E of 16.53, highlighting a mixed competitive landscape. Recent stock performance shows LPL Financial Holdings outpacing the S&P 500, with a 1-year return of 33.36% compared to the S&P 500's 19.89%. This strong performance may suggest that the market still has confidence in the company's growth potential despite its current fair valuation....

Read MoreIs LPL Financial Holdings, Inc. technically bullish or bearish?
2025-10-07 12:15:39As of 3 October 2025, the technical trend for LPL Financial Holdings, Inc. has changed from mildly bullish to mildly bearish. The MACD indicates a bearish stance on the weekly chart and a mildly bearish stance on the monthly chart. The Bollinger Bands are bearish on the weekly and sideways on the monthly, while the moving averages show a mildly bullish signal on the daily timeframe. Dow Theory reflects a mildly bearish outlook for both weekly and monthly periods. The KST is bearish weekly but bullish monthly, and the OBV is mildly bearish on the monthly timeframe. In terms of performance, LPL Financial has underperformed the S&P 500 across the 1-week, 1-month, and year-to-date periods, with returns of -8.34%, -6.25%, and -4.39% respectively, while the S&P 500 returned 1.09%, 4.15%, and 14.18% in those same periods.
